Abstract: The present paper consists in the analysis of Rain Drop Size Distribution (RDSD) measurements gathered by an optical based disdrometer. The main precipitation parameters such as accumulated amount, rain rate and median volume equivalent diameter for each episode are recalculated from corrected drop concentration per volume of air after applying a quality control fillter. We put special emphasis on how different microphysical processes related to drop formation and evolution can be associated to RDSD modifications.
